When danger strikes, most people instinctively move away from it. Fire, violence, accidents, and disasters trigger a natural desire to find protection and safety. Yet first responders do the opposite. Firefighters, police officers, and paramedics run toward the very scenes others are fleeing. They enter burning buildings, approach violent situations, and kneel beside the injured in chaotic moments. This response is unexpected because it goes against basic human instinct.

God calls us to be spiritual first responders when we see people in trouble because of sin. Instead of self-preservation and comfort, we choose service to them and to our Lord. Our motive is the grace of God and his desire for the salvation of all mankind.

✨Grace Wins in Real Life✨

Real life can bring doubts, failures, disappointments, and situations that feel impossible. But the good news of the gospel is that we don't have to prove ourselves to God.

In Romans 4, we see that Abraham was not declared righteous because of his works. He believed God's promise, and God credited that faith as righteousness. The same promise is ours in Christ. Jesus died for our sins and was raised to give us righteousness. Our hope isn't found in what we can do, but in what Christ has already done for us.

GETTING TO KNOW PASTOR BISHOP - HIS MINISTRY JOURNEY

So, how did Pastor Bishop end up at Peace? 😊

After graduating from Wisconsin Lutheran Seminary, Josh was assigned to serve at Peace Lutheran Church in Kokomo, Indiana. He served there for five years before accepting a call to serve as Youth and Family Pastor at Grace Lutheran Church in St. Joseph, Michigan.

Throughout his ministry, one thing has remained especially important to Pastor Bishop: building relationships with people and strengthening their connection to Jesus as their Savior.

We’re excited to see how God will use those gifts here at Peace as we grow together in his Word and serve one another!
